A319454 Number of partitions of 2n into exactly n nonzero decimal palindromes.
1, 1, 2, 3, 5, 7, 11, 15, 22, 29, 41, 53, 72, 92, 121, 153, 197, 245, 310, 381, 475, 579, 711, 858, 1043, 1248, 1501, 1783, 2126, 2507, 2966, 3476, 4083, 4757, 5551, 6433, 7464, 8606, 9931, 11398, 13089, 14957, 17099, 19461, 22153, 25120, 28483, 32183, 36361
Offset: 0

Maple
p:= proc(n) option remember; local i, s; s:= ""||n; for i to iquo(length(s), 2) do if s[i]<>s[-i] then return false fi od; true end: h:= proc(n) option remember; `if`(n<1, 0, `if`(p(n), n, h(n-1))) end: b:= proc(n, i, t) option remember; `if`(n=0, 1, `if`(i<1 or t<1, 0, b(n, h(i-1), t)+b(n-i, h(min(n-i, i)), t-1))) end: a:= n-> `if`(n=0, 1, b(2*n, h(2*n), n)-b(2*n, h(2*n), n-1)): seq(a(n), n=0..70);
